What's in a TGI Fridays Loaded Cheese Fry Burger?

Loaded Cheese Fry Burger

Before we dive into the calorie count, it's worth examining the ingredients that make up this burger. According to TGI Fridays' menu, the Loaded Cheese Fry Burger includes:

  • A beef patty
  • Melted cheddar cheese
  • Crispy bacon
  • Seasoned fries
  • Lettuce, tomato, and red onion (optional)

Calories and Nutrition Facts

Calories

According to TGI Fridays' official nutritional information, the Loaded Cheese Fry Burger clocks in at a whopping 1,610 calories. That's nearly an entire day's worth of calories for the average adult! In addition to the high calorie count, this burger also contains:

  • 115 grams of fat
  • 3,340 milligrams of sodium
  • 89 grams of carbohydrates
  • 46 grams of protein
  • 4 grams of sugar

These numbers paint a pretty clear picture of just how indulgent this burger really is. With such a high calorie count and sodium content, it's definitely not a dish you should be eating on a regular basis if you're watching your weight or trying to maintain a healthy diet.

Alternatives to the Loaded Cheese Fry Burger

Healthy Alternatives

So, if the Loaded Cheese Fry Burger isn't exactly a health food, what are some alternatives you can try if you're in the mood for a burger? Here are a few ideas:

  • Choose a smaller patty size
  • Opt for a turkey or veggie patty instead of beef
  • Skip the cheese and bacon
  • Swap out the fries for a side salad or grilled vegetables

By making a few simple swaps, you can still enjoy the delicious flavors of a burger without all the excess calories and fat. And if you do decide to indulge in a Loaded Cheese Fry Burger from time to time, just be sure to balance it out with plenty of nutrient-rich foods and regular exercise.
